South Street is the best place to get a feel for a Philly’s culture. From the local shops, live music venue to the restaurants and bars and the best cheesesteak! (In my humble opinion). Don’t miss the funky, weird and risqué shops if you want some real local flavor! You have access to the parks on the rivers on either end of the street as well as the most historic part of Philly- Society Hill right off the street. You could easily spend all day roaming South Street and the surrounding areas.

Parks & Nature

This park is walking distance from our house. The path goes up the river for miles and takes you past iconic Boathouse row and the Philly art museum. You can also stop off at center city or cross the south street bridge to go to U of Penn campus

Getting Around

Philly’s Subway system only runs north/south and east/west. But it does run quickly and often for $2. Making it a good way to get to points of interest around the city
